OngoingClean-Up-A-ThonClean Jordan Lake is seeking volunteers for the 22nd annual Haw River Assembly's Clean-Up- A-Thon from 9 a.m. to 1 p.m. March 17 beginning at the Robeson Creek boat ramp. Boaters and walkers will be assigned different shoreline sections. Wear rugged clothes and shoes and bring rain gear if needed. Children under 11 are not allowed to pick up trash.

Good Neighbor PlanThe Good Neighbor Plan will meet 4-7 p.m. at the United Church of Chapel Hill, 1321 Martin Luther King Jr. Blvd. The Inter-Faith Council created the Good Neighbor Plan for understanding among neighbors, congregations, businesses and other groups near the proposed site for Community House.
